I'm not going to go through every complaint option but, as an example, I'll breakdown the mortar issue.
Mortars are likely overpowered at the moment. God cam + 3 round loads make it a formidable weapon, and that has gained the ire of a lot of complaints. I do agree a small nerf could be hugely beneficial (god cam shouldn't show unspotted players). However, here's the play pattern I've seen.
Mortar'd > Revived > Return to exactly what I was doing before > Repeat. Later that night post a, "Mortars are OP, I quit" complaint to the social media void.
If you don't see the insanity in that, I am talking to you. If you're downed and you notice your whole base is littered with 4-12 other bodies all bc of mortars, you gotta make a change.
Solution, regroup. If you're lucky enough to get revived, gtfo. Leave the fob, it is no longer safe. or Respawn, grab an assault kit. and Communicate, join a squad, local chat at spawn, hit enter and drop a team text. The message, "Let's go get those mortar bastards". Rush their fob. Some mortar-ing fobbits never come up for air and certainly don't hear you coming until your grenade blows up by their feet. You were the fish in the barrel, now's time to turn the tables.
